Behind the scenes pictures of Nick Castle (Michael Myers) enjoying a Dr Pepper on the set of Halloween 1978 and 2018.
this spooky fella is just having a classic gooferoni and cheese over here
Behind the scenes pictures of Nick Castle (Michael Myers) enjoying a Dr Pepper on the set of Halloween 1978 and 2018.
this spooky fella is just having a classic gooferoni and cheese over here